Amber Rose was on Entertainment Tonight to speak about her Twitter spat with Khloe Kardashian. Rose stressed that she doesn't hate Khloe at all.

"I don't hate Khloe. I don't hate her," said Khloe. "I could have totally minded my own business when it came to her sister...But, me being a dancer at such a young age, dealing with older men gave me the humility and knowledge to speak on such a subject. [But] I can understand why it came across the wrong way to her. I get it. But, that's a phone call she could have had with me."

The incident between the youngest Kardashian sister and Amber sparked following a Power 105 interview with Amber, in which the busty model said that the Kylie Jenner is a baby and that Tyga should be ashamed of himself for dating her. Amber’s comments pissed Khloe off so much, that the Kardashian vented on Twitter and the battle was on. Following that, Kanye made his return to The Breakfast Club, where he had some pretty unflattering words about his ex-girlfriend saying, “If Kim had like dated me when I first wanted to be with her, there wouldn’t be an Amber Rose,” 'Ye said. “I had to take 30 showers I got with Kim.”

Rose addressed Kanye's comments immediately on Twitter but discussed the incident with ET's Brooke Anderson "We were happy when we were together! And now all of the sudden, I'm getting slut-shamed because we're not together anymore and it's not fair."
